Can an accountant afford rent in Garden Home-Whitford, OR?
Median rent in Garden Home-Whitford is $2,358 a month. A typical accountant in Oregon earns about $94,411 a year, which makes that rent 30%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is yes.
How much rent can an accountant afford in Garden Home-Whitford?
Using the 30% rule, an accountant salary in Oregon (~$94,411/yr) supports up to $2,360 a month in rent. Garden Home-Whitford's current median rent is $2,358/mo, which leaves a $2/mo buffer.
How many hours does an accountant work to cover rent in Garden Home-Whitford?
At an hourly equivalent of about $45 an hour, an accountant in Oregon works roughly 51.9 hours a month to cover Garden Home-Whitford's median rent of $2,358.
